One of the brothers of Sohrabuddin Sheikh, Nayamuddin, who is a witness in the fake encounter killing case, has alleged CBI has altered his statement and included some portions which he never said before it.

In a two-page affidavit sent to the special CBI court of Additional Chief Judicial Magistrate A Y Dave here today,
Nayamuddin said three points, which he had not stated to CBI, have been included in his statement. Of the three points, the first is that one of the arrested IPS officers in the case, Abhay Chudasama, had asked him to withdraw the petition filed in Supreme court in encounter case.

Second, Chudasama had threatened him in the name of Madhya Pradesh government to get the petition withdrawn and third that he was given inducement by Chudasama to do the same.

Nayamuddin has said in the affidavit that after CBI filed the chargesheet in the case on July 23, he came to know that
these three points were added in his statement without his knowledge or consent.

He has further stated that he was filing this affidavit so that no innocent person is affected by the incorrect portions included in his statement.
